For better protection of human rights
News:
- The recently approved the Protection of Human Rights (Amendments) Bill, 2018 seeks to empower the National Human Rights Commission (NHRC) and State Human Rights Commissions (SHRC)
Important Facts:
- Aim:Better protection and promotion of human rights in India
- It is an amendment to the Protection of Human Rights Act, 1993
- The amendment will make NHRC and SHRCs more compliant with the Paris Principle in terms of autonomy and will help the institutions effectively protect and promote human rights
- Key Proposals
- Proposes to include “National Commission for Protection of Child Rights” as deemed Member of the Commission
- Proposes one additional woman member in the composition of the Commission
- Proposes to enlarge the scope of eligibility and selection of Chairperson of NHRC as well as the State Human Rights Commission
- Proposes to incorporate a mechanism to look after the cases of human rights violation in the Union Territories
